Economic affairs minister Azmin Ali in discussion with Abu Dhabi’s crown prince, Sheikh Mohamed bin Zayed Al Nahyan.

Azmin posted on Twitter that the discussions took place during his audience with the Crown Prince of Abu Dhabi, Sheikh Mohamed bin Zayed Al Nahyan. Mubadala owns International Petroleum Investment Company which was involved in a 2017 deal involving a US$5.78 billion settlement of a bond dispute with Malaysia’s scandal-hit 1Malaysia Development Bhd, the investment arm of the former Malaysian government.

He said there were discussions on setting up a Joint Investment Committee to boost investments between both countries, to be co-chaired by the respective ministers from the two countries..
